Your GP practice

Seaforth Village Surgery, Litherland Practice, Netherton Practice, Crosby Village Surgery, Thornton Practice and Crossways Practice have been run by an organisation called Primary Care 24 since 2017.

All these practices were rated ‘good’ by the Care Quality Commission (CQC) when it last inspected the standard of the care they provide.

They serve a total of 16,801 patients and you can see the numbers for each practice in the table below:

Seaforth Village Surgery 2068 Thornton Practice 2832
Litherland Practice 3715 Crosby Village Surgery 3002
Netherton Practice 2684 Crossways Practice 2500

About Primary Care 24

The Liverpool based organisation provides a range of urgent and primary care services to just over 1.3 million people across Halton, Liverpool, Knowsley, St Helens, south Sefton, Southport and Formby and Warrington. Primary Care 24 is a social enterprise, so it has members rather than shareholders and operates on a not for profit basis.

About NHS South Sefton CCG

NHS South Sefton Clinical Commissioning Group (CCG) is made up of 29 GP practices and covers a population of nearly 157,000 patients.

We are responsible for planning and buying nearly all healthcare services that our residents need from a range of providers. Working with NHS England, we have responsibility for managing primary care services in the area.
